I was a Palm user until I bought nokia 770. Now I'm trying to import
contacts from my Palm device to GPE Contacts.

To achieve this, I synchronize my Palm with JPilot, then I select
Contacts, Export to VCard, and I get file will all my contacts in
VCard. The file looks encoded in UTF-8. For example, a contact that
should be:

Ba?uelo

is encoded as:

Ba??uelo

So far, everything is Ok. The problem is when importing the VCard to
GPE Contacs. If I import the file "as is", I get a "double utf-8"
encoding in the contacs, so Ba?uelo becomes:

Ba????uelo

where ???? is the UTF-8 encoding for ??

If I convert the VCard file to iso8859-1 before importing, after
importing I get:

Ba??uelo

So, maybe there is something wrong with the encoding in sqlite? Any
idea will be welcome!
